Trump's campaign in turmoil
Sky News ^ | 08/09/2015

Posted on 08/08/2015 7:16:30 PM PDT by E. Pluribus Unum

Organisers of a Republican event withdrew frontrunner Donald Trump's invitation after he suggested that a presidential debate moderator was tough on him because she was menstruating.

The off-handed comment unleashed a new storm of criticism against Trump as he seeks the party's nomination for next year's election and leads in the polls.

The bombastic billionaire came under fire from his party after a particularly crude accusation that Fox News' Megyn Kelly - one of the moderators at Thursday's Republican presidential debate - singled him out with rough treatment.

Trump had already called out the station's moderators for asking 'unfair' questions after Kelly brought up his use of derogatory language towards women in Twitter posts. Kelly asked him if this was befitting a man vying to be the US president.

But he turned up the tone on Friday evening when he told CNN that Kelly 'is just somebody I didn't have a lot of respect for'.

'You can see there was blood coming out of her eyes, blood coming out of her wherever,' he continued.

Those remarks prompted a prominent grassroots Republican event in Atlanta - RedState Gathering - to rescind a speaking invitation for Saturday.

Meanwhile, Trump's campaign told various US media on Saturday that he sacked top political advisor Roger Stone, as the controversy churned on.

'Roger wanted to use the campaign for his own personal publicity ... and Mr Trump wants to keep the focus of the campaign on how to Make America Great Again,' a campaign spokesperson told CNN.

Stone, however, took issue on Twitter with that version of events.

'Sorry realDonaldTrump didn't fire me - I fired Trump. Diasagree (sic) with diversion to food fight with megynkelly away core issue messages,' he wrote.

Carly Fiorina, the only female Republican presidential candidate, tweeted: 'Mr. Trump: There. Is. No. Excuse.'

She later added 'I stand with megynkelly.'

Trump tried late Saturday to backtrack from the comment about Kelly, stating that he was not referring to the body part most people had in mind from his remark on blood.

'Re Megyn Kelly quote: 'you could see there was blood coming out of her eyes, blood coming out of her wherever' (NOSE). Just got on w/thought,' Trump tweeted.

'So many 'politically correct' fools in our country. We have to all get back to work and stop wasting time and energy on nonsense!' he also tweeted.
